    Royals revel in comeback

    21 Aug 2006 - 10:04:00

    Reading manager Steve Coppell was delighted with the spirit of his Royals side after they marked their Premiership debut with a superb 3-2 comeback win over Middlesbrough.

    Boro raced into a two-goal lead thanks to Stewart Downing and Yakubu, before Reading gave their fans something to cheer about as Dave Kitson, Steve Sidwell and Leroy Lita turned the game on its head.

    Coppell said afterwards: "It was an exciting performance for sure, both managers will have certain aspects to complain about, but from our point of view it was a terrific performance to come back from two down.

    "We started very nervously and were very anxious, but when the second goal went in the players just seemed to say 'sod it' and then they relaxed.

    "The timing of the first goal was critical and when it went in, Boro seemed to be looking for half-time while we built up a tempo. I certainly didn't want half-time to come.

    "A disappointing start was pure anxiety, there wasn't necessarily an indication of that in the dressing room beforehand, but there has been such a build-up to this being our first ever Premiership game, that it was human nature for them to react in the way that they did.

    "For the first 20 minutes our passing was poor, but those players didn't want to wimp out and they started stringing passes together and doing the things they had been doing last season."
